I did it using a different project of mine but you can use it for anything. If you need help using it on your project ask me and I'll help. For some reason I can't get the Decoded list to appear. This project broke somehow. go look at my other one. I think I overloaded the sprite.
I know there are easier ways of doing this but this way is more fun. Once Code List Is Full Tap or Click To Transfer Delay is on purpose. Turbo to skip delay